Look no further! We have an exciting and rewarding opportunity to join our Kinship Team as a Link Worker here at Stockton On Tees Borough Council.



This is a new and exciting opportunity to be part of the development of Stockton Borough Council's Kinship support offer.



The Kinship Team will strive to support children remaining in their family network. We recognise the positive impact that placing children in Kinship care can have on their overall wellbeing and outcomes. As a Link Worker Kinship Support you will offer direct support to kinship carers, including out of hours and on a weekend, offering advice and guidance in respect of parenting children and young people who have experienced trauma, in order to promote stability of placement. Support will include targeted pieces of work to support individual kinship carers to manage when challenges arise, contributing to assessments of need, arranging and facilitating peer support groups and events for kinship families as well as signposting to other services.



The successful candidate will be joining the Kinship Team, within the Family Placement Service and will work alongside social workers across the service. This is an exciting time to join the team as we move towards the development of a service, which will provide consistency, training and support for both foster carers and kinship carers, enabling children and young people to experience permanence and stability within their network.



We are a dedicated team, passionate about improving the lives of our children and young people and ensuring kinship carers get the support and recognition they deserve.



The successful candidate will have good knowledge of kinship care and the rewards and challenges of caring for children who have experienced trauma. They should have significant experience of working with children and families and be able to work in partnership with families during times of crisis as well as to develop and maintain positive working relationships in the longer term.



Applicants must be able to demonstrate excellent communication, relationship building and organisational skills and be able to work under their own initiative as well as part of a team.
